Job description

An externship experience at an NVA hospital provides students with a unique opportunity to understand the daily operations of a veterinary practice and gain valuable hands-on clinical experience. While each NVA hospital is unique, common qualities include a supportive environment, a commitment to excellent medicine, and a focus on providing exceptional service to animals and their owners.

Parkersburg Veterinary Hospital is a busy five-doctor practice located in western West Virginia. We emphasize a team approach, encouraging case discussions among staff, which externs are welcome to participate in. During the externship, based on your educational level, you can expect to observe doctors during appointments, perform physical exams, assist in creating diagnostic and treatment plans, and communicate with clients about treatments. Opportunities may also include assisting in surgeries and performing minor procedures such as spays and neuters independently. Our goal is to provide as much real-world experience as possible under the guidance of our experienced veterinary staff, enhancing your education through hands-on learning.

Externships typically last from two to eight weeks, depending on student and hospital schedules. These externships are designed for third and fourth-year veterinary students.
